When: Kendace Calcareous Silt Member (Belmont Formation), Early/Lower Miocene (23.0 - 16.0 Ma)

• The principal, nominal sedimentary units of the mid-Tertiary succession of Carriacou are the Belmont Formation (lower Miocene), Kendeace Formation (lower Miocene), Carriacou Formation (middle Miocene) and Grand Bay Formation (middle Miocene). The collection originates from the Kendace Calcareous Silt Member of the Belmont Fm. Jung (1971) assigns an Early Miocene age. The age is determined relative (underlying) to the Grand Bay Formation, as the other units are small and poorly preserved.

• bed-level stratigraphic resolution

Environment/lithology: deep-water; poorly lithified, calcareous siltstone

• Probably deposited in deep-water, approximately greater than 200, but no deeper than 800 m.
• Calcareous siltstone. From specimens presented in photgraphic plates most material from Carriacou appears to be from poorly-lithified as opposed to cemented, or unconsolidated sediments. No information provided in text
